Understanding the Core Mechanics
The gameplay of this chicken-crossing endeavor is deceptively straightforward. Players utilize simple controls – typically taps, swipes, or keyboard presses – to maneuver their avian protagonist across multiple lanes of traffic. The objective is to navigate through gaps in the oncoming vehicles, timing movements precisely to avoid collisions. Each successful crossing awards points, and the score typically increases proportionally to the distance covered, encouraging players to riskier maneuvers for greater rewards. A common mechanic involves accelerating the speed of the cars as the player progresses, or introducing new types of vehicles with unpredictable movement patterns. The longer the chicken survives, the more challenging the experience becomes, ensuring a continuous test of skill and concentration.
The Role of Reflexes and Timing
Success in this type of game hinges entirely on quick reflexes and impeccable timing. The window of opportunity to safely cross a lane is often incredibly small, requiring players to anticipate the movements of approaching vehicles and react accordingly. Unlike complex strategy games, there’s little room for elaborate planning; it’s a reactive experience where split-second decisions determine survival. Practice is key, as players gradually learn to recognize patterns in the traffic flow and develop the muscle memory needed to execute precise movements. The instant feedback of either a successful crossing or a disastrous collision also contributes to the learning process, reinforcing good habits and discouraging reckless behavior.

The Psychology of Addictive Gameplay
Several psychological principles contribute to the addictive nature of these types of games. Variable ratio reinforcement schedules, where rewards are given unpredictably, are particularly effective at maintaining engagement. Players are kept on their toes, constantly anticipating the next reward, even if it doesn't come immediately. The feeling of “just one more try” is a common phenomenon, as players attempt to beat their previous score or overcome a particularly difficult obstacle. Furthermore, simple, intuitive controls make these games accessible to a wide audience, while the inherent challenge provides a sense of mastery and satisfaction for those who invest the time to improve. The visual and auditory feedback – bright colors, catchy music, and satisfying sound effects – also contribute to the overall positive experience.

The Influence of Power-Ups and Collectibles
Power-ups offer a temporary advantage, allowing players to overcome otherwise insurmountable obstacles or achieve higher scores. Common power ups might include temporary invincibility, increased speed, or the ability to slow down time. Collectible items, on the other hand, serve as long-term rewards, unlocking new content, characters, or cosmetic upgrades. The strategic use of power-ups and the pursuit of collectibles add a layer of complexity to the gameplay, encouraging players to think beyond simply crossing the road and to plan their movements accordingly. The scarcity of these items also contributes to the sense of accomplishment when they are finally obtained, reinforcing the addictive loop.
- Temporary Invincibility: Allows the chicken to pass through vehicles without harm.
- Speed Boost: Increases the chicken's movement speed for a short duration.
- Time Slow: Reduces the speed of traffic, making it easier to navigate.
- Magnet: Attracts nearby collectible items.
- Double Points: Multiplies the score earned for a limited time.
Effective implementation of these additions is crucial. Overly powerful or frequent power-ups can diminish the sense of challenge, while overly rare or difficult-to-obtain collectibles can lead to frustration. Striking the right balance is key to maintaining player engagement and ensuring a rewarding experience.
